User Notes: Installation of Polkit There should be a dedicated user and group to take control of the polkitd daemon after it is started. Issue the following commands as the root user: groupadd -fg 27 polkitd && useradd -c "PolicyKit Daemon Owner" -d /etc/polkit-1 -u 27 \ -g polkitd -s /bin/false polkitd First, fix problems with setting permissions during installation and with meson-0.60.0: sed '/0,/s/^/#/' -i meson_post_install.py && sed '/policy,/d' -i actions/meson.build \ -i src/examples/meson.build Install Polkit by running the following commands: mkdir build && cd build && meson --prefix=/usr \ -Dman=true \ -Dsession_tracking=libsystemd-login \ --buildtype=release \ .. && ninja mkdir build && cd build && meson --prefix=/usr \ -Dman=true \ -Dsession_tracking=libelogind \ -Dsystemdsystemunitdir=/tmp \ --buildtype=release \ .. && ninja This package does not ship with a working test suite. Configuring Polkit PAM Configuration If you did not build Polkit with Linux PAM support, you can skip this section. If you have built Polkit with Linux PAM support, you need to modify the default PAM configuration file which was installed by default to get Polkit to work correctly with BLFS. Issue the following commands as the root user to create the configuration file for Linux PAM: cat > /etc/pam.d/polkit-1 << "EOF" # Begin /etc/pam.d/polkit-1 auth include system-auth account include system-account password include system-password session include system-session # End /etc/pam.d/polkit-1 EOF Contents Installed Programs Installed Libraries Installed Directories pkaction, pkcheck, pkexec, pkttyagent and polkitd libpolkit-agent-1.so and libpolkit-gobject-1.so /etc/polkit-1, /usr/include/polkit-1, /usr/lib/polkit-1, /usr/share/gtk-doc/html/polkit-1 and /usr/share/polkit-1 Short Descriptions pkaction is used to obtain information about registered PolicyKit actions pkaction pkcheck is used to check whether a process is authorized for action pkcheck pkexec allows an authorized user to execute a command as another user pkexec pkttyagent is used to start a textual authentication agent for the subject pkttyagent polkitd provides the org.freedesktop.PolicyKit1 D-Bus service on the system message bus polkitd libpolkit-agent-1.so contains the Polkit authentication agent API functions libpolkit-agent-1.so libpolkit-gobject-1.so contains the Polkit authorization API functions libpolkit-gobject-1.so
